/foundation/multimedia/media_library/frameworks/innerkitsimpl/test/fuzztest/medialibraryappurisensitiveoperations_fuzzer/ |
H A D | medialibraryappurisensitiveoperations_fuzzer.cpp | 92 static void HandleInsertOperationFuzzer(string appId, int32_t photoId, int32_t sensitiveType, int32_t permissionType, in HandleInsertOperationFuzzer() argument 98 values.Put(Media::AppUriSensitiveColumn::HIDE_SENSITIVE_TYPE, sensitiveType); in HandleInsertOperationFuzzer() 141 int32_t sensitiveType = FuzzHideSensitiveType(data, size); in AppUriSensitiveOperationsFuzzer() local 145 HandleInsertOperationFuzzer(appId, photoId, sensitiveType, permissionType, uriType); in AppUriSensitiveOperationsFuzzer() 146 sensitiveType = FuzzHideSensitiveType(data, size); in AppUriSensitiveOperationsFuzzer() 147 HandleInsertOperationFuzzer(appId, photoId, sensitiveType, permissionType, uriType); in AppUriSensitiveOperationsFuzzer()
|
/foundation/multimedia/media_library/frameworks/innerkitsimpl/medialibrary_data_extension/src/ |
H A D | medialibrary_urisensitive_operations.cpp | 192 int32_t sensitiveType = values.at(index).Get(AppUriSensitiveColumn::HIDE_SENSITIVE_TYPE, isValid); in GetSingleDbOperation() local 194 if (sensitiveType == querySingleResultSet.at(SENSITIVE_TYPE_INDEX)) { in GetSingleDbOperation() 229 int32_t sensitiveType = values.at(0).Get(AppUriSensitiveColumn::HIDE_SENSITIVE_TYPE, isValid); in BatchUpdate() local 235 valuesBucket.Put(AppUriSensitiveColumn::HIDE_SENSITIVE_TYPE, sensitiveType); in BatchUpdate() 246 static void AppstateOberserverBuild(int32_t sensitiveType) in AppstateOberserverBuild() argument 277 int32_t sensitiveType = values.at(0).Get(AppUriSensitiveColumn::HIDE_SENSITIVE_TYPE, isValid); in InsertValueBucketPrepare() local 278 insertValues.Put(AppUriSensitiveColumn::HIDE_SENSITIVE_TYPE, sensitiveType); in InsertValueBucketPrepare() 305 int32_t sensitiveType = values.at(0).Get(AppUriSensitiveColumn::HIDE_SENSITIVE_TYPE, isValid); in GrantUriSensitive() local 306 AppstateOberserverBuild(sensitiveType); in GrantUriSensitive()
|
H A D | medialibrary_app_uri_sensitive_operations.cpp | 48 // sensitiveType from param in HandleInsertOperation() 61 // Update the sensitiveType in HandleInsertOperation() 115 // sensitiveType from param in BatchInsert() 251 bool MediaLibraryAppUriSensitiveOperations::IsValidSensitiveType(int &sensitiveType) in IsValidSensitiveType() argument 253 bool isValid = AppUriSensitiveColumn::SENSITIVE_TYPES_ALL.find(sensitiveType) in IsValidSensitiveType() 256 MEDIA_ERR_LOG("invalid SensitiveType=%{public}d", sensitiveType); in IsValidSensitiveType()
|
/foundation/multimedia/media_library/frameworks/innerkitsimpl/test/fuzztest/medialibraryurisensitiveoperations_fuzzer/ |
H A D | medialibraryurisensitiveoperations_fuzzer.cpp | 93 static void InsertOperationFuzzer(string appId, int32_t photoId, int32_t sensitiveType, int32_t uriType) in InsertOperationFuzzer() argument 98 values.Put(Media::AppUriSensitiveColumn::HIDE_SENSITIVE_TYPE, sensitiveType); in InsertOperationFuzzer() 146 int32_t sensitiveType = FuzzHideSensitiveType(data, size); in UriSensitiveOperationsFuzzer() local 149 InsertOperationFuzzer(appId, photoId, sensitiveType, uriType); in UriSensitiveOperationsFuzzer()
|
/foundation/multimedia/media_library/frameworks/utils/src/ |
H A D | media_privacy_manager.cpp | 303 static int32_t CollectRanges(const string &path, const HideSensitiveType &sensitiveType, PrivacyRanges &ranges) in CollectRanges() argument 305 if (sensitiveType == HideSensitiveType::NO_DESENSITIZE) { in CollectRanges() 320 switch (sensitiveType) { in CollectRanges() 331 MEDIA_ERR_LOG("Invaild hide sensitive type %{public}d", sensitiveType); in CollectRanges() 336 MEDIA_ERR_LOG("Failed to get privacy area with type %{public}d, err: %{public}u", sensitiveType, err); in CollectRanges() 392 HideSensitiveType sensitiveType = in GetPrivacyRanges() local 394 int32_t err = CollectRanges(path, sensitiveType, ranges); in GetPrivacyRanges()
|
/foundation/multimedia/media_library/frameworks/innerkitsimpl/medialibrary_data_extension/include/ |
H A D | medialibrary_app_uri_sensitive_operations.h | 86 static bool IsValidSensitiveType(int &sensitiveType);
|
/foundation/multimedia/media_library/frameworks/js/src/ |
H A D | media_library_napi.cpp | 5017 static bool ParseUriTypes(std::string &appid, int &permissionType, int &sensitiveType, std::vector<std::string> &uris, in ParseUriTypes() argument 5035 valuesBucket.Put(AppUriSensitiveColumn::HIDE_SENSITIVE_TYPE, sensitiveType); in ParseUriTypes()
|